3 «IC Net»

The 761 SD Compact IC can be operated via «IC Net» or «IC Cap» (see

Section 4). System and method settings can be modified only with «IC

Net». Use of «IC Cap» is advisable for day-to-day operation. «IC Cap» is

an interface with a simplified GUI which can be used to control the «IC

Net» software.

This Section discusses the most important points of operation of the

761 SD Compact IC via «IC Net». For further details, please refer to

the supplied Software Instructions for Use «IC Net 2.3» (8.110.8283)

and the Online Help in the «IC Net» program.

3.1.1

Systems - Methods

The Systems contain all instrument settings, time programs, the data

recording parameters and a linked process method which has been

optimised for the determination process to be performed (see Software

Instructions for Use «IC Net 2.3», Section 4).
Four systems (

startup.smt

,

manual.smt

,

auto.smt

and

shutdown.smt

, see

Section 3.2) are supplied for soft drink analysis. They are saved as sys-

tem files (

*.smt

) in the

Systems

directory.

To each system a method (

SD_startup.mtw

/

SD_phosphate.mtw

(linked

with

manual.smt

and

auto.smt

) /

SD_shutdown.mtw

) is linked . A method

contains all information required for data acquisition, integration, peak

evaluation and result calculation. It can be considered as an empty

chromatogram, i.e. a chromatogram without data. Methods are saved

as method files (

*.mtw

) in the

Methods

directory (see Software Instruc-

tions for Use «IC Net 2.3», Section 7).

3.1.2

Opening a system

A system window can be opened with

IC Net / File / Open / System

and

selecting the required system file. It contains icons for data recorders,

Watch window (screen) and all devices which have been installed in

the system. Opening displays the System window on the screen. Here,

we can see the example system window for the

manual.smt

system:
